What Is Dry Ice Cleaning?
Solidified carbon dioxide cleansing, likewise recognized as carbon dioxide cleaning, is an ingenious approach that uses strong carbon dioxide pellets to get rid of contaminants from different surface areas. This technique functions by accelerating solidified carbon dioxide pellets with a nozzle, creating a powerful jet that blasts away dirt, oil, and various other undesirable materials. You'll discover it efficient on a vast array of surfaces, including steel, wood, and also fragile electronics.
It doesn't leave any residue because the dry ice sublimates directly right into gas upon contact with the surface. And also, completely dry ice cleaning is quick and efficient, allowing you to recover surface areas without lengthy downtime.
The Scientific Research Behind Solidified Carbon Dioxide Cleaning
Utilizing the concepts of thermodynamics and kinetic energy, completely dry ice cleaning effectively gets rid of contaminants from surface areas. When you spray solidified carbon dioxide pellets onto a surface, they rapidly sublimate, transforming from solid to gas. This process develops a remarkable decline in temperature, creating contaminants to end up being brittle and loosen their bond with the surface area.
As the pellets impact the surface, they move kinetic energy, successfully displacing dirt, oil, and other unwanted products. The CO2 gas created throughout sublimation expands and develops small shockwaves, better aiding in the elimination of these contaminants.
This cleansing method is non-abrasive and leaves no residue behind, making it suitable for delicate surfaces. You don't require to fret about harsh chemicals or water damage, as solidified carbon dioxide cleansing is both environmentally friendly and effective. By understanding this science, you can value exactly how dry ice cleaning provides an one-of-a-kind solution for surface remediation.
